> The problem I'm running into appears to be caused by the installed
> version of python being 2.5.  Cmake requests a version of 2.5 or later
> so it should be okay, however I get the following error.
> 
> Serf:gnuradio-build ben$ make
> [  0%] Generating ../include/volk/volk.h, volk.c, volk_init.h,
> ../include/volk/volk_typedefs.h, ../include/volk/volk_cpu.h,
> volk_cpu.c, ../include/volk/volk_config_fixed.h,
> volk_environment_init.c, volk_environment_init.h, volk_machines.h,
> volk_machines.c, volk_machine_generic.c, volk_machine_sse2_only.c,
> volk_machine_sse2_32.c, volk_machine_sse3_32.c,
> volk_machine_ssse3_32.c
> Unknown option: -B
> usage: 
> /System/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.5/Resources/Python.app/Contents/MacOS/Python
> [option] ... [-c cmd | -m mod | file | -] [arg] ...
> Try `python -h' for more information.
> make[2]: *** [volk/include/volk/volk.h] Error 2
> make[1]: *** [volk/lib/CMakeFiles/volk.dir/all] Error 2
> make: *** [all] Error 2
> 
> A google suggests that the -B option for python was added in 2.6.
> I'll install a newer version of python and see if I have more luck.
> 

The -B tells python not to generate .pyc files (to keep junk from being
generated in tree). I didnt realize it was for 2.6 and up.

For now, you can harmlessly remove it, or alternatively, disable volk
-DENABLE_VOLK=ON/OFF
